Verbal taxi clearance system
First Claim
1. A verbal taxi clearance system for an aircraft, comprising:
- a broadcast communication system;
an input system;
a processor communicatively coupled to the communication system and the input system, the processor configured to;
receive, from the broadcast communication system, first audio data broadcast by air traffic control;
convert the first audio data broadcast by air traffic control into first taxi route data using a radio acoustic model;
receive, from the input system, second audio data generated by a crew member in a cockpit of the aircraft;
convert the second audio data into second taxi route data utilizing a cockpit acoustic model;
receive, from the broadcast radio communication system, third audio data;
convert the third audio data into third taxi route data utilizing the radio acoustic model;
compare the first taxi route data to the second taxi route data and the third taxi route data;
output, when the first taxi route data matches the second taxi route data and the third taxi route data, a taxi route corresponding to the first and second taxi route data; and
generate an alert when the first taxi route data does not match the second taxi route data and the third taxi route data.

Abstract
A verbal taxi clearance system for an aircraft and a method of controlling the same are provided. The system, for example, may include, but is not limited to a communication system, and a processor communicatively coupled to the communication system, the processor configured to receive, from the communication system, first audio data from air traffic control, convert the first audio data from air traffic control into first taxi route data, receive second audio data from a cockpit of the aircraft, convert the second audio data into second taxi route data, compare the first taxi route data to the second taxi route data, output, when the first taxi route data matches the second taxi route data, a taxi route corresponding to the first and second taxi route data, and generate an alert when the first taxi route data does not match the second taxi route data.

8. A method for operating a verbal taxi clearance system for an aircraft, comprising:
-
receiving, by a processor from a communication system, first audio data broadcast by air traffic control; converting, by the processor, the first audio data from air traffic control into first taxi route data utilizing a radio acoustic model; receiving, by the processor, second audio data generated by a crew member in a cockpit of the aircraft; converting, by the processor, the second audio data into second taxi route data; receive, by the processor, third audio data generated by the crew member in the cockpit of the aircraft; convert, by the processor, the third audio data into third taxi route data; comparing, by the processor, the first taxi route data to the second taxi route data and the third taxi route data; outputting, by the processor, when the first taxi route data matches the second taxi route data and the third taxi route data, a taxi route corresponding to the first and second taxi route data; and generating, by the processor, an alert when the first taxi route data does not match the second taxi route data and the third taxi route data. - View Dependent Claims (9, 10, 11, 12, 13)
